The 10 Best Nursing Homes in Sacramento, CA for 2024

Sacramento is the capital of the state of California and is known as the produce capital of the country. The city has a population of 513,624, and about 13.1% of residents are aged 65 and older. Seniors in Sacramento have access to excellent healthcare at UC Davis Medical Center, which is a teaching hospital that’s nationally ranked by USN in nine adult specialties.

Nursing home care provides around-the-clock medical care and assistance to seniors who have chronic diseases or are extremely frail. This type of care is often expensive and isn’t necessary for all seniors. Loved ones may want to look at alternative care options such as home health care and assisted living. According to the Genworth Cost of Care Survey 2020, the average cost of nursing home care in Sacramento is $9,946 for a semiprivate room, which is higher than the national average of $7,756.

This guide looks at the costs of nursing home care in Sacramento and surrounding cities as well as the costs of alternative care options. Additionally, it looks at free resources for seniors in the Sacramento area.

Nursing Home Costs in Sacramento, California

The average monthly cost of nursing home care in Sacramento is $9,946 for a semiprivate room and $13,688 for a private room.

The Cost of Nursing Home Care in Nearby Cities

Seniors may be interested in the costs of nursing home care in nearby cities. Using the average monthly cost of a semiprivate room as a comparison point, the cost of nursing home care in Sacramento is much higher than the national average of $7,756. However, it’s similar to the California state average of $9,247.

The average monthly cost of nursing home care in the nearby cities of Santa Rosa ($9,946), Vallejo ($9,429) and Santa Cruz ($9,201) are similar to the costs in Sacramento. However, the average cost of care is much higher in San Francisco at $12,471 per month.

The Cost of Other Types of Senior Care

Seniors and their loved ones may be interested in the costs of alternative care options in Sacramento. The cheapest option is adult day care at an average cost of $1,918 per month, while assisted living has an average monthly cost of $5,395. Home care and home health services both have a monthly average cost of $5,863. At the other end of the price scale, nursing home care has an average monthly cost of $9,946 for a semiprivate room and $13,688 for a private room.

Financial Assistance for Nursing Home Care in Sacramento, California

Many seniors and their families use some form of financial assistance to help them pay for nursing care. The main options available are Medicare, Medicaid, and veterans benefits. These programs can be complicated, especially when it comes to benefit terms. Below, we give a brief overview of how these programs may be used towards paying for skilled nursing care.

  • Medicare: Medicare will typically cover all skilled nursing costs for the first 20 days of one’s stay in a nursing home and a portion of the costs until day 100. After 100 days in a skilled nursing facility, Medicare will not cover any part of the cost of the stay. While this is adequate when short-term care is needed, those in need of long-term care will need to either pay out-of-pocket or use another source of financial assistance.
  • Medicaid: Medicaid covers most of the costs of living in a skilled nursing facility for those who qualify. Care, room, and board are covered with no time limit, but residents may be charged for extras like specially prepared food or cosmetic services. Medicaid eligibility standards are strict and complex, so not all seniors are eligible for Medicaid benefits.
  • Veterans Benefits: Veterans receiving a VA pension may also be eligible for the Aid and Attendance benefit administered by the VA. Aid and Attendance is a monthly allowance that beneficiaries may use to pay for their long-term care, including skilled nursing care.

If these options aren’t available to you, check if your loved one has long-term care insurance or contact your Area Agency on Aging to ask about any local financial assistance programs for seniors.

Free Resources for Seniors in Sacramento, California

A range of free resources is available for seniors in Sacramento who wish to remain in their homes for as long as safely possible. One of the resources provides information services for seniors who have decided to move to nursing home care and need help working out possible financial assistance options.

ResourceContactService
Meals on Wheels(916) 444-9533Meals on Wheels by ACC delivers meals to homebound seniors aged 60 and over in Sacramento County who are unable to prepare a meal for themselves. Eligible seniors must lack consistent support or assistance and are subject to an assessment to determine if they qualify. Volunteers deliver a meal around noon each day from Monday to Friday. Three times a week, meal enhancements such as salads or desserts are included. The volunteers carry out a safety check when delivering the meals and will report any concerns to the relevant authorities. There’s no charge for the meals, but donations are appreciated. 
ACC Rides(916) 393-9026 ext. 333The ACC Rides Transportation Service provides door-to-door transportation for seniors aged 60 and over who can’t drive or don’t have access to a car. Transport is provided to congregate meal sites, senior centers, medical appointments, field trips and grocery stores. There’s no charge for the service, but donations are welcomed.
State Health Insurance Assistance Programs(800) 434-0022The California Health Insurance Counseling and Advocacy Program assists seniors by providing free and unbiased information on health care options in the state. Staff members are available 24/7 to provide information and ensure seniors are making the best choices for their health requirements. The counselors can help seniors in applying for any financial assistance benefits they may be eligible for. They can also help locate nursing care homes that accept Medicare and other health insurance benefits.
